Top Tips for Winning Remote Communication
Working remotely presents special challenges when it comes to communication. To ensure seamless collaboration and productivity, follow these top tips:
* **Be Clear and Concise:** When communicating via email or instant message, compose your messages in a clear manner.
Avoid jargon and presume that your recipient has all the necessary context.
* **Over-Communicate:** Don't be afraid to contact your colleagues frequently, even for minor details. This helps to keep everyone and prevent misunderstandings from arising.
* **Utilize Video Conferencing:** Whenever possible, conduct video conferences to facilitate face-to-face interaction. Seeing your colleagues' body language can strengthen communication and build stronger relationships.
* **Set Clear Expectations:** From the outset, establish clear expectations regarding communication channels, response times, and meeting schedules. This helps to prevent ambiguity and promote a sense of efficiency.
* **Be Respectful of Time Zones:** When working with colleagues in multiple time zones, be mindful of their schedules and avoid scheduling meetings during inconvenient hours.

Finding Online Work 101: Finding Your Perfect Fit
Landing your dream remote job requires a focused and strategic approach. First, pinpoint your desired field. What type of work are you passionate about? Consider your skills and recognize roles that align with them.
Next, dive into the world of remote job boards. Explore platforms like We Work Remotely to find a wealth of opportunities. Tailor your resume to showcase your relevant skills and experience for each application.
Finally, ace those interviews! Practice answering common remote work questions and show your ability to thrive in a virtual environment. Remember, persistence is key – don't get discouraged if you face rejections along the way.
